安装环境准备
在安装 HENGSHI SENSE 时,请检查安装环境是否满足以下配置。
软件环境推荐
HENGSHI SENSE 使用的软件环境如下所示:
- 操作系统
类别 | 架构 | 操作系统 | 已验证版本号 |
---|---|---|---|
Linux | x86/arm | Centos | 7.x 8.x 系列 |
Linux | x86/arm | RedHat | 7.x 系列 |
Linux | x86/arm | Ubuntu | 18.x、20.x、21.x、22.x 系列 |
Linux | x86/arm | 麒麟 OS | v10 系列 |
Linux | x86 | OpenAnolis(龙蜥) | 7.x 8.x 系列 |
Linux | x86 | openEuler(欧拉) | 20.x 系列 |
Linux | x86 | UOS(统信) | v20(1060) 系列 |
Windows | x64 | Windows Server | 2008、2012、2016、2019 系列 |
Windows | x64 | Windows | Windows7、Windows10 |
- 其他
类别 | 版本信息 |
---|---|
JDK 版本 | JDK11 |
使用 Greenplum 引擎 | 依赖 Python 版本为2.7 |
使用 Doris 引擎 | 依赖 JDK 版本为1.8 |
浏览器 | 单核心:谷歌、火狐、Safari、opera。从渲染引擎的匹配度上,建议使用:谷歌、火狐。双核心:360 浏览器、搜狗浏览器、QQ 浏览器、UC 浏览器、猎豹浏览器、百度浏览器,只支持其极速模式,不支持兼容模式 |
请注意
若部署环境为离线环境且不可以连接互联网时,请参考离线环境依赖包安装
硬件配置推荐
- 主要为初始配置建议, 进入测试阶段后则需要根据测试环境的具体表现进行配置调整
根据分析数据量推荐
- 所有数据开启加速引擎
- 只在单一表上进行分析
数据量(单位:行) | CPU | 内存 | 可用磁盘空间 |
---|---|---|---|
0 ~ 1000万 | 8线程 | 16G ~ 24G | 100G |
1000万 ~ 5000万 | 16线程 | 24G ~ 32G | 500G |
5000万 ~ 1亿 | 16线程 | 32G ~ 64G | 500G ~ 1T |
根据用户量推荐
并发用户量 | CPU | 内存 |
---|---|---|
50 | 8线程 | 16G |
95 | 16线程 | 24G |
135 | 24线程 | 32G |
数据集成性能
数据量(行/列) | 抽取到 Greenplum |
---|---|
100万/9 | 约6秒 |
1000万/9 | 约39秒 |
1亿/9 | 约5分钟 |
10亿/9 | 约52分钟 |
- 由于抽取数据速度受网络速度以及磁盘 io 性能影响极大,本次测试业务数据库到 Greenplum 库网络带宽为4.9Gbits/sec,磁盘均为 ssb 网盘,本次结果对此环境中的环境配置有效。
安装文件准备
安装前请下载 hengshi 安装包hengshi-sense-<version>.zip
,并解压到hengshi-<version>
目录中。
sh
mkdir hengshi-sense-<version> && unzip -qod hengshi-sense-<version>/ hengshi-sense-<version>.zip
提示
如果不清楚安装包下载方式请通过邮箱 support@hengshi.com 进行咨询。